About

I was born in Egypt to Irish and Scottish parents. I studied Fine Art at the University of Nottingham and graduated with a BA in 2013. I have been a finalist in the Derwent Drawing Prize showing at the Mall Gallery in London as well as in the prestigious Jerwood Drawing Prize in 2016.
